What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es a window or door system that includes two glass panes, separated by an area filled with an inert gas (typically argon or krypton). This area minimizes heat transfer and improves the thermal efficiency of a home. The essential benefits include:
Energy Efficiency: Helps in maintaining constant indoor temperatures, decreasing heating and cooling costs substantially.Sound Insulation: The gap between the panes serves as a barrier to outside noise, making living or working environments quieter.Security: Double glazed windows are harder to break compared to single-pane windows, offering enhanced security to homes and homes.Reduced Condensation: The insulation homes minimize the likelihood of condensation forming on the interior surface areas.The Importance of Experience in Installation

The Process of Double Glazing Installation
The installation of double glazing is a detailed treatment that includes numerous actions:

Assessment: A professional will perform a preliminary evaluation to evaluate the present condition of windows and figure out the best approach.

Measurement: Precise measurements are required to guarantee an ideal suitable for the new double-glazed units.

Selection of Glass: The customer may choose between various types of glass, such as Low-E glass for better energy efficiency.

Installation: The installation process starts with the elimination of existing windows (if necessary) followed by the cautious fitting of new double-glazed units.

Ending up Touches: Sealing and finishing work is finished to boost the aesthetic appearance and ensure thermal performance.

Final Inspection: An extensive inspection is carried out to validate that all installations meet the expected standards.

The length of time does double glazing last?
Double glazing can last between 20 to 35 years, depending upon the quality of materials utilized and the installation process.
2. Can I replace single-glazed windows with double-glazing myself?
While some house owners may think about DIY installation, it is advisable to hire specialists to guarantee ideal performance and compliance with structure policies.
3. Is double glazing worth the financial investment?
Yes, double glazing is generally regarded as a beneficial investment due to its energy-saving benefits, increased home value, and improved convenience.
4. What maintenance does double glazing require?
Maintenance is minimal, generally including periodic cleansing of the glass surfaces and checking for seals and frames for any wear and tear.
5. How does double glazing minimize sound?
The space between the 2 glass panes functions as a sound barrier, lessening the transmission of noise into a Residential Window Replacement or commercial property.
